Understanding Reasonable NoClone Home Edition

Reasonable NoClone Home Edition is a software application designed to detect and remove duplicate files from your computer. Its intuitive interface makes it accessible for users of all skill levels. Unlike many complex storage management solutions, NoClone focuses specifically on eliminating redundancy, helping users free up valuable disk space.

Why Duplicates Are a Problem

Having duplicate files can lead to various issues, including:

  • Wasted Storage Space: Duplicate files consume unnecessary space, leading to reduced storage efficiency.
  • File Confusion: When multiple copies of the same file exist, it can become challenging to determine which one is the most recent or relevant.
  • Slower Performance: Excess files may slow down your system’s performance, especially during searches or backups.

Removing duplicates with Reasonable NoClone can solve these issues effectively.


Tips for Maximizing Storage with NoClone Home Edition

Now, let’s explore some strategic tips to harness the full potential of Reasonable NoClone Home Edition.

1. Perform Regular Scans

To maintain an organized storage environment, schedule regular scans.

  • Daily or Weekly: Depending on your usage, set the tool to scan daily for active file users or weekly for less frequent file managers.
  • File Types: Customize your scans to target specific file types if you’re looking to free up space quickly.
2. Use Advanced Filters

One of the strengths of NoClone is its advanced filtering options.

  • By File Size: Filter by file size to find and relocate or delete large duplicate files that take up significant space.
  • File Type Filters: Focus on specific file types (e.g., images, documents) that often accumulate duplicates.

This targeted approach can save you time and provide clear insights into where most duplicates are located.

3. Review Suggested Duplicates Carefully

When NoClone presents potential duplicates for you to review, take time to carefully assess each suggestion.

  • Preview Files: Use the preview feature before removing files to ensure you don’t accidentally delete important documents.
  • Check Metadata: Pay attention to file creation and modification dates to determine which version you may want to keep.

Ensuring accuracy in your selections can prevent data loss and make your storage management efforts more effective.

4. Leverage the Archive Feature

If you’re hesitant about permanently deleting files, NoClone’s archiving feature is a wise choice.

  • Temporary Removal: Archive duplicates instead of deleting them outright, allowing you to restore any mistaken removals later.
  • Create Folders: Organize archived files into specific folders, making it easy to navigate if you need to retrieve them later.

This feature allows you to gradually optimize storage while maintaining a safety net for important files.

5. Integrate with Cloud Storage Solutions

Consider connecting NoClone with your cloud storage solutions.

  • Automatic Syncing: When you delete duplicates from your local device, sync these changes with your cloud storage, ensuring you have ample space in both areas.
  • Backup Your Deletes: Before running a comprehensive cleanup, back up your files to the cloud. This ensures a second copy if you mistakenly delete something.

Integrating with the cloud can greatly enhance your overall storage management strategy.
